Nettet8. des. 2024 · Mr. Darcy's best friend, Mr. Bingley, comes from a family who acquired their fortune in trade. His father worked hard as a merchant of some kind, which improved their financial and social status. Nettet29. mar. 2014 · Mr. Bingley was considered wealthy, and his income was estimated at only 5,000 a year. That was quite a chunk of annual income in the days when a family of seven, like the Bennetts, could live on 2,000 a year and still afford to dress decently, travel in a limited way, keep servants and a country estate, and set a fine table. Even with her terrible personality, … pascal waldvogel lörrachNettetCaroline Bingley is Bingley's youngest sister. She is a superficial and selfish girl, possessing all of Darcy's class prejudice but none of his honor and virtue. Throughout the novel, she panders to Darcy in an attempt to win his affections, but to no avail.
